Office of Inter-College Advising

The Office of Inter-College Advising is responsible for leading university wide academic advising initiatives with the goal of developing strategies that enhance the student academic experience and which helps students to fulfill their educational goals. The Office supports the fundamental mission of academic advisors across campus who provide guidance and support to students navigating curricular and co-curricular subject matter. In addition, the Inter-College Advising team seeks to collaborate across academic units to help create a positive collective impact on the recruitment and retention of Drexel students.

Goals and values include:

  • Lead and execute best practices of the academic advising profession.
  • Enhance the student educational experience while engaging the student as an active participant.
  • Strive to standardize and elevate the undergraduate and graduate academic advising practices across all of Drexel’s colleges and schools through the development of training programs and analytical reporting.
  • Build strategic partnerships with schools, colleges and academic units to support individual student case management.
  • Facilitate collaborations between advising units and academic support services on campus, especially the Center for Learning and Academic Success Services (CLASS) and Learning Alliance partners.
  • Support university wide retention initiatives with the goal of helping to increase the first to second year retention rate among undergraduate students.
  • Support university wide retention initiatives with the goal of helping to increase the six-year undergraduate graduation rate.
